Julio Llamazares.  La lentitud de los bueyes.  1979. 48 pp.  
This book made an impact in its day, though Llamazares is now better known for his novels.  When I first read it, it hadn't yet read Gamoneda, so in some sense my perspective was distorted.  Not that it's an exact copy of Gamoneda, but I believe that's the context in which it should be read.  
The book itself holds up fine.
